The Transformation Manager is responsible for leading strategic initiatives and projects that improve how Enclave Property Management operates. This role serves as a catalyst for organizational transformation by partnering with leadership to design plan govern implement and measure initiatives that enhance operational performance elevate the resident and employee experience and position the organization for scalable growth.

Strategic Initiative Leadership:
- Lead enterprise-wide strategic initiatives from concept through operational adoption.
- Partner with leadership to translate strategic priorities into executable implementation plans.
- Develop comprehensive initiative plans including scopeobjectives milestones timelines deliverables resource requirements dependencies communication strategies and measurable success criteria.
- Manage multiple concurrent strategic initiatives while balancing organizational priorities and operational capacity.
- Facilitate cross-functional collaboration to ensure alignment accountability and successful execution.
- Identifyorganizational risks implementation barriers and resource constraints while proactively developing mitigation strategies.
- Maintain visibility into initiative progress and organizational impacts throughout theimplementationlifecycle.
Business Transformation & Process Improvement:
- Evaluate existing business processes andidentifyopportunities to improve operational efficiency consistency scalability and the overall resident and employee experience.
- Lead cross-functional process redesign initiatives that align with organizational strategy and Standards of Excellence.
- Facilitate discovery sessions workflow analysis and future-state process design.
- Document operational workflows business requirements decision points and organizational impacts.
- Ensure process improvements balance operational effectiveness compliance technology capabilities financial considerations and long-term sustainability.
